CHILI MAC SKILLET
Speedy stovetop preparation makes this flavorful zippy main dish a winner at my table.-Tracy Golder, Bloomsburg, Pennsylvania
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 30m
Yield 8 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Cook macaroni according to package directions. Meanwhile, in a large skillet, cook the beef, onion and green pepper over medium heat until meat is no longer pink and vegetables are tender. Add garlic; cook 1 minute longer. Drain. , Stir in the tomatoes, beans, corn, chili powder, salt and cumin.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 15 minutes or until heated through. , Drain the macaroni and add to skillet; stir to coat. Sprinkle with cheese.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 266 calories, Fat 8g fat (4g saturated fat), Cholesterol 34mg cholesterol, Sodium 402mg sodium, Carbohydrate 31g carbohydrate (5g sugars, Fiber 6g fiber), Protein 19g protein.

SUNNY'S TEX-MEX CHILI MAC SKILLET
Provided by Sunny Anderson
Categories main-dish
Time 40m
Yield 4 to 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Preheat the oven or a grill to 375 degrees F.
- Add the olive oil, chili powder and cumin to a large cast-iron pan over medium heat. Toast and stir until the spices are fragrant, about 2 minutes. Add the beef, salt and a few grinds of black pepper and cook, breaking the beef into bits while browning, until fully cooked, 8 to 10 minutes. Add the marinara sauce and stir to coat. Add the pasta straight from the bag and stir.
- Level the contents of the pan and top with the cheese, then arrange the jalapeno slices around the pan on top. Bake or grill with the lid closed until the cheese melts and is golden on the edges, 10 to 15 minutes. Top with the Greek yogurt and scallions. Serve warm.

EASY SKILLET CHEESE-TOPPED CHILI MACARONI
This is a quick and easy recipe for a weeknight meal. Its very tasty and very filling. DH loves it when I make this and always takes leftovers to work!
Provided by Little Bee
Categories One Dish Meal
Time 30m
Yield 6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- In a large skillet, brown onion and garlic with ground beef.
- Drain and return to pan.
- Add kidney beans, tomato sauce, water, chili powder, and salt.
- Cover and simmer for 15-20 minutes.
- Add cooked macaroni and stir.
- Add grated cheddar to top, cover and simmer just until cheese melts.
